Summary
II-VI Incorporated (now known as Coherent Corp.) announced on June 20, 2017, the acquisition of Integrated Photonics, Inc. for approximately $45.0 million in cash at closing, with potential earn-out payments of up to $2.5 million. Integrated Photonics is a specialist in engineered magneto-optic materials crucial for high-performance directional components, particularly optical isolators used in the optical communications market. This acquisition signals II-VI's strategic move to enhance its capabilities within the optical communications sector by integrating advanced materials and component technology. Importantly, the company also affirmed its previously issued revenue and Earnings Per Share (EPS) guidance for its fourth fiscal quarter ended June 30, 2017. This indicates that management does not anticipate the acquisition to materially impact its short-term financial outlook, providing a level of certainty for investors amidst the strategic growth initiative. The filing incorporates the press release detailing this acquisition.
